C,F,G,L,N,O,P,R,T,U,VBotzaris (damask, Robert, 1856)

Damask, Hybrid Gallica.  Cream, ages to white .  Strong, damask fragrance.  Medium to large, double (17-25 petals), flat, quartered bloom form.  Once-blooming spring or summer.  USDA zone 4b through 9b.  
Height: 39" to 5'1" (100 to 155cm).  Width: up to 3' (up to 90cm). Robert (1856).
